St Michael's Manor is a hotel in the oldest part of St Albans, beside the Roman remains at Verulamium, with five acres of private gardens and a lake behind it. It publishes a clean, specific licence: licensed for civil ceremonies for up to 140 guests, with 30 boutique bedrooms for an exclusive-use weekend.
It is also the venue in this set where we would raise catering first rather than last. The hotel does not publish a caterer policy either way, while third-party reviews state plainly that external catering is not allowed, citing its two AA Rosettes. If that is right, it shapes what kind of Asian wedding is possible here — and it is the one thing to settle before falling for the lake.

St Michael's Manor: licence, grounds and rooms
| Address | Fishpool Street, St Albans, Hertfordshire AL3 4RY |
|---|---|
| Civil ceremonies | The hotel states it is licensed for civil ceremonies for up to 140 guests |
| Capacity | 14 to 140, per its own description of intimate weddings up to grander occasions |
| Grounds | Five acres of private gardens with a private lake |
| Accommodation | 30 boutique bedrooms, available for exclusive use |
| Catering | The hotel publishes no policy. Third-party reviews state external catering is not permitted, citing two AA Rosettes. Confirm this in writing first. |
| Not published | Per-room capacities, which rooms are licensed, curfew, confetti rules, parking detail and prices |
| Setting | Fishpool Street, in the historic quarter of St Albans near Verulamium Park |
Figures are as published by the venue or its licensing authority on 2026-08-26. Where a venue's own pages disagree, both are shown. Confirm anything you are planning around.
The catering question that decides this venue
The licence is stated cleanly, which is more than most manage: licensed for civil ceremonies for up to 140 guests. What the hotel does not publish is which rooms carry that licence, so if a particular room matters — and with a lake behind the building, it will — that needs confirming.
Catering is the decisive question and the hotel is silent on it. Its own wedding pages talk about bespoke proposals and direct couples to download a brochure or book a showcase, without stating a policy on outside caterers. Third-party reviews are not silent: they say external catering is not allowed, and attribute that to the hotel's two AA Rosettes and its own kitchen reputation. We cannot verify that from the hotel itself, so we report both positions rather than pick one.
If external catering is genuinely not permitted, this is a venue for a civil ceremony and a reception with hotel catering rather than for a full Hindu, Sikh or Muslim wedding with its own kitchen. That is not a criticism of the hotel — it is simply the fact that decides whether it belongs on your shortlist. Ask, and ask specifically about a vegetarian kitchen and halal provision if either matters.
A private lake, five acres, and a 140 ceiling
- The lake and five acres of gardens are the reason to shoot here. They sit behind the hotel, away from Fishpool Street, so portraits are private without leaving the grounds.
- 140 is the ceiling on the licence, so this is a smaller wedding by Asian standards. The upside is that the whole group fits in one frame by the water.
- Which rooms are licensed is not published. If you want the ceremony facing the garden, confirm the room before the timeline is fixed.
- Fishpool Street is a narrow historic street. Arrival pictures work, but a large car or a baraat needs the hotel's guidance on where it can actually stop.
- Verulamium Park and the Roman wall are a short walk away and give a completely different backdrop if there is a gap in the schedule. Agree the walking time first.
- 30 bedrooms on site mean preparation can happen at the venue. Ask which rooms take morning light.
A hotel on Fishpool Street, beside Roman Verulamium
The hotel stands on Fishpool Street, the old road running down from St Albans towards the site of Roman Verulamium, in what is now the most complete historic street in the city. Behind it lie five acres of private gardens and a lake, which is what separates it from other hotels of its size. Inside there are 30 boutique bedrooms, and the hotel offers itself for exclusive use so that a wedding party has the building to itself. The hotel does not publish a listing status, a build date or an architect on its wedding pages, so we do not assert one.
St Albans AL3, and a narrow historic street
Fishpool Street, St Albans AL3 4RY. St Albans City station is the main rail approach from London, and the M25 and M1 are both close. Parking is referred to in reviews rather than published as a policy, so confirm the space count if a large group is arriving by car — Fishpool Street itself is narrow and historic, and is not the place to discover a parking problem on the morning.
